Position Overview:As a Mail Carrier, you will play a crucial role in keeping USPS operations running efficiently. Your duties will include selling stamps, receiving and processing mail, sorting and distributing mail, and performing various clerical tasks. Additionally, you'll provide essential customer service by assisting with post office box services, mail holds, and address changes. This role offers numerous opportunities for career advancement within USPS.
Job Details:USPS is committed to providing long-term job security, which is a top priority for many employees. To be eligible for employment, applicants must be at least 18 years old and a U.S. citizen or lawful permanent resident.
